Cancer concepts and principles: primer for the interventional oncologist-part II
Ryan Hickey1, Michael Vouche, Daniel Y Sze
1Department of Radiology and Division of Interventional Oncology, Northwestern University, Chicago, IL 60611, USA.
Abstract:
This is the second of a two-part overview of the fundamentals of oncology for interventional radiologists. The first part focused on clinical trials, basic statistics, assessment of response, and overall concepts in oncology. This second part aims to review the methods of tumor characterization; principles of the oncology specialties, including medical, surgical, radiation, and interventional oncology; and current treatment paradigms for the most common cancers encountered in interventional oncology, along with the levels of evidence that guide these treatments.
